Again, here's how the Power Rankings voting will work:
* This thread will be open until Sunday, May 24th.
* Voters are to rank the Top 20 cards for the GREEN group according to what they would take at Pack 1, Pick 1 (P1P1) in a regular draft. Partial lists will not be accepted.
* Please rank your cards from #1 through #20, with #1 being the card you would take over all the others.
* The VOTING thread is for posting your votes only. Small discussions about the voting, in particular pointing out errors in other voter's rankings and questions about the voting process, are allowed within reasonable length, but otherwise you should use the main CPR thread for discussions.
* Results will be posted in their own thread after this one is closed and all the votes are compiled.
* You can edit your vote freely, up until the moment the thread is closed.

About Oath of Druids, yeah it's super fun and powerful! Our group likes to play it in UG deck with counterspells, draw spells, none-creature ramp spells, planeswalkers and none-creature-feel-like-a-creature spells (Bribery, Control Magic, Shackles, Beast Within, etc). Was even having Call of the Herd at a time before I squeeze up my list a bit. Black also helps to tutor it.
Green has been, by far, the hardest top 20 to put together yet. The first four cards on my list will put me into green as of P1P1. The rest of the cards will almost never be taken that early and are usually just really solid support cards that don't normally wheel.

HOW TO VOTE ON SIMILAR CARDS
The following cards are considered to be equal. If you include them in your vote, they must be ranked as a single entry.
Llanowar Elves = Elvish Mystic = Fyndhorn Elves
And the following cards, despite having very similar effects, are not considered equal and must be ranked at separated entries:
Viridian Shaman x Uktabi Orangutan
Sylvan Tutor x Worldly Tutor
Kodama's Reach x Cultivate
===
CARDS THAT ARE INCLUDED ON THIS VOTING
According to the rules at the main thread, the following cards are included in the BLACK voting group:
* Gaea's Cradle, Treetop Village, Yavimaya Hollow and any other land able to produce only green mana, or that produces colorless mana but has abilities costing green mana (and no other color).
* Birthing Pod, Mutagenic Growth, Noxious Revival and other "hybrid" red/colorless cards.
* Wall of Tanglecord, Tangle Golem, Shrine of Boundless Growth and other colorless artifacts with abilities costing green mana or that requires you to control forests, green permanents or play green spells.
** Special case for green: Birds of Paradise and other green cards able to produce mana "of any color".
CARDS THAT ARE NOT INCLUDED ON THIS VOTING
Also according to the rules, the following cards are included in other voting groups and must not be voted here:
* Vivid Grove and other lands able to produce 'mana of any color', even if their 'main' color is green. Their voting group is LANDS.
* Wild Nacatl, Flinthoof Boar, and any other green card with abilities that cost mana of other colors or that require you to control lands of other basic types. Their voting group is GUILD or SHARD/WEDGE.
** Special case for green: Avacyn's Pilgrim, Rattleclaw Mystic, Noble Hierarch and other green cards able to produce mana of one or two non-green colors. Their voting groups is also GUILD or SHARD/WEDGE.
* Wilt-Leaf Liege, Tattermunge Maniac, Deathrite Shaman and other hybrids cards with other color. Their voting group is also GUILD or SHARD/WEDGE.
* Mox Emerald, Copper Myr and other colorless artifacts that produce red mana but has no ability costing red mana or that requires you to control mountains. Their voting group is COLORLESS.
